To Thomas Jefferson from Robert Smith, 26 June 1806

June 26. 1806

sir,

The Navy agent has been instructed to pay to mr. Reich to the full amount of the memm. which you furnished me. This he will not accept. Presuming upon your friendly interposition he treats with disdain every proposition made by us. And he has allowed himself to talk so much about what you would direct to be done, that with some in Philada it has become a question whether you will interfere in such a case. If you do, I fear you will hereafter be much harrassed by appeals from our decisions, as we often have to resist exorbetant demands.

Respectfully Your Obt. Servt.

Rt Smith
